    Sun's Jones earns All-WNBA First Team honors

    Connecticut Sun forward Jonquel Jones earned her first All-WNBA First Team honor Friday as the only unanimous selection.

    Jones, who won her first WNBA MVP honor this season, received 49 First-Team votes, as chosen by a national panel of sportswriters and broadcaster. Jones is a two-time Second Team pick.

    Jones averaged 19.4 points, 11.2 rebounds, 1.26 blocked shots and 1.26 steals this year to help the Sun to their most successful regular season in franchise history. They finished with the highest winning percentage in franchise history (.813), the fewest losses in franchise history (a 26-6 record), and had a franchise-record 14-game winning streak, the fourth longest in league history.

    Center Brittney Griner of the Phoenix Mercury, forward Breanna Stewart and guards Jewell Loyd (Seattle Storm) and Skylar Diggins-Smith (Phoenix Mercury) were all chosen to the First Team.

    Center Sylvia Fowles (Minnesota Lynx), forwards Tina Charles (Washington Mystics) and A'ja Wilson (Las Vegas Aces) and guards Arike Ogunbowale (Dallas Wings) and Courtney Vandersloot (Chicago Sky) make up the Second Team.
